Heritage and Craftsmanship

The Minnetonka Moccasin Company was founded in 1946 by three brothers who shared a passion for Native American culture. Inspired by the moccasins worn by the indigenous tribes of the Great Plains, they began crafting their own moccasins using traditional methods.

These early moccasins were made from high-quality leather, often adorned with intricate beadwork and embroidery. They were meticulously handmade, ensuring both durability and a snug fit.

Today, Minnetonka shoes continue to be crafted with the same meticulous attention to detail. Skilled artisans use only the finest materials, including genuine leather, suede, and soft textiles, to create shoes that are both stylish and enduring.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

While Minnetonka shoes are generally easy to care for, there are a few common mistakes to avoid:

  • Over-Cleaning: Minnetonka shoes are made from natural materials that can be damaged by excessive cleaning. Spot clean only as needed using a damp cloth and mild soap.
  • Using Harsh Chemicals: Avoid using harsh chemicals, such as bleach or solvents, to clean Minnetonka shoes. These chemicals can damage the leather or suede.
  • Machine Washing: Never machine wash Minnetonka shoes. This can cause the shoes to shrink or lose their shape.

How to Step-By-Step Approach to Care for Minnetonka Shoes

  1. Brush: Use a soft brush to remove any dirt or debris from the shoes.
  2. Spot Clean: If the shoes have any stains, use a damp cloth with mild soap to gently clean the affected area.
  3. Air Dry: Allow the shoes to air dry completely after cleaning. Do not put them in the dryer or near a heat source.
  4. Condition: Once the shoes are completely dry, apply a leather conditioner to help preserve the leather and protect it from moisture.
